Dela via


Planera för ditt Avere vFXT-system

Den här artikeln beskriver hur du planerar ett nytt Avere vFXT för Azure-kluster som är positionerat och storleksanpassat efter dina behov.

Innan du går till Azure Marketplace eller skapar några virtuella datorer bör du tänka på följande information:

  • Hur interagerar klustret med andra Azure-resurser?
  • Var ska klusterelement finnas i privata nätverk och undernät?
  • Vilken typ av serverdelslagring kommer du att använda och hur kommer klustret att komma åt det?
  • Hur kraftfulla behöver dina klusternoder vara för att stödja arbetsflödet?

Fortsätt att läsa om du vill veta mer.

Lär dig komponenterna i systemet

Det kan vara bra att förstå komponenterna i Avere vFXT för Azure-systemet när du börjar planera.

  • Klusternoder – Klustret består av tre eller flera virtuella datorer som konfigurerats som klusternoder. Fler noder ger systemet högre dataflöde och en större cache.

  • Cache – Cachekapaciteten delas lika mellan klusternoderna. Ange cachestorleken per nod när du skapar klustret. nodstorlekarna läggs till för att bli den totala cachestorleken.

  • Klusterstyrenhet – klusterstyrenheten är en ytterligare virtuell dator som finns i samma undernät som klusternoderna. Kontrollanten behövs för att skapa klustret och för pågående hanteringsuppgifter.

  • Serverdelslagring – De data som du vill ha cachelagrade lagras långsiktigt i ett maskinvarulagringssystem eller en Azure Blob-container. Du kan lägga till lagring när du har skapat Avere vFXT för Azure-klustret, eller om du använder Blob Storage kan du lägga till och konfigurera containern när du skapar klustret.

  • Klienter – Klientdatorer som använder cachelagrade filer ansluter till klustret med hjälp av en virtuell filsökväg i stället för att komma åt lagringssystemen direkt. (Läs mer i Montera Avere vFXT-klustret.)

Prenumeration, resursgrupp och nätverksinfrastruktur

Överväg var elementen i din Avere vFXT för Azure-distribution kommer att vara. Diagrammet nedan visar ett möjligt arrangemang för Avere vFXT för Azure-komponenter:

Diagram showing the cluster controller and cluster VMs within one subnet. Around the subnet boundary is a vnet boundary. Inside the vnet is a hexagon representing the storage service endpoint; it is connected with a dashed arrow to a Blob storage outside the vnet.

Följ dessa riktlinjer när du planerar avere vFXT-klustrets nätverksinfrastruktur:

  • Skapa en ny prenumeration för varje Avere vFXT för Azure-distribution. Hantera alla komponenter i den här prenumerationen.

    Fördelarna med att använda en ny prenumeration för varje distribution är:

    • Enklare kostnadsspårning – Visa och granska alla kostnader från resurser, infrastruktur och beräkningscykler i en prenumeration.
    • Enklare rensning – Du kan ta bort hela prenumerationen när du är klar med projektet.
    • Bekväm partitionering av resurskvoter – Isolera Avere vFXT-klienter och kluster i en enda prenumeration för att skydda andra kritiska arbetsbelastningar från eventuell resursbegränsning. Den här separationen förhindrar konflikter när du tar upp ett stort antal klienter för ett arbetsflöde för databehandling med höga prestanda.
  • Leta upp dina klientberäkningssystem nära vFXT-klustret. Serverdelslagring kan vara mer fjärransluten.

  • Leta upp vFXT-klustret och den virtuella klusterstyrenhetsdatorn tillsammans – mer specifikt bör de vara:

    • I samma virtuella nätverk
    • I samma resursgrupp
    • Använda samma lagringskonto

    Mallen för att skapa kluster hanterar den här konfigurationen i de flesta situationer.

  • Klustret måste finnas i ett eget undernät för att undvika IP-adresskonflikter med klienter eller andra beräkningsresurser.

  • Använd mallen för att skapa kluster för att skapa de flesta infrastrukturresurser som behövs för klustret, inklusive resursgrupper, virtuella nätverk, undernät och lagringskonton.

    Om du vill använda resurser som redan finns kontrollerar du att de uppfyller kraven i den här tabellen.

    Resurs Vill du använda befintlig? Behov
    Resursgrupp Ja, om det är tomt Måste vara tomt
    Lagringskonto Ja om du ansluter en befintlig blobcontainer efter att klustret har skapats
    Nej om du skapar en ny blobcontainer när klustret skapas
    Den befintliga blobcontainern måste vara tom
     
    Virtuellt nätverk Ja Måste innehålla en slutpunkt för lagringstjänsten om du skapar en ny Azure Blob-container
    Undernät Ja Det går inte att innehålla andra resurser

KRAV för IP-adress

Kontrollera att klustrets undernät har ett tillräckligt stort IP-adressintervall för att stödja klustret.

Avere vFXT-klustret använder följande IP-adresser:

  • En IP-adress för klusterhantering. Den här adressen kan flyttas från nod till nod i klustret efter behov så att den alltid är tillgänglig. Använd den här adressen för att ansluta till konfigurationsverktyget för Avere Kontrollpanelen.
  • För varje klusternod:
    • Minst en klientriktad IP-adress. (Alla klientriktade adresser hanteras av klustrets vserver, som kan flytta IP-adresserna mellan noder efter behov.)
    • En IP-adress för klusterkommunikation
    • En instans-IP-adress (tilldelad till den virtuella datorn)

Om du använder Azure Blob Storage kan det också kräva IP-adresser från klustrets virtuella nätverk:

  • Ett Azure Blob Storage-konto kräver minst fem IP-adresser. Tänk på det här kravet om du hittar Blob Storage i samma virtuella nätverk som klustret.
  • Om du använder Azure Blob Storage som ligger utanför klustrets virtuella nätverk skapar du en slutpunkt för lagringstjänsten i det virtuella nätverket. Slutpunkten använder inte någon IP-adress.

Du har möjlighet att hitta nätverksresurser och Blob Storage (om det används) i olika resursgrupper från klustret.

vFXT-nodstorlek

De virtuella datorer som fungerar som klusternoder avgör dataflödet och lagringskapaciteten för din cache.

Varje vFXT-nod är identisk. Om du skapar ett kluster med tre noder har du alltså tre virtuella datorer av samma typ och storlek.

Instanstyp vCPU:er Minne Lokal SSD-lagring Maximalt antal datadiskar Diskdataflöde som inte är anslutet Nätverkskort (antal)
Standard_E32s_v3 32 256 GiB 512 GiB 32 51 200 IOPS
768 Mbit/s
16 000 Mbit/s (8)

Diskcache per nod kan konfigureras och kan rasa från 1 000 GB till 8 000 GB. 4 TB per nod är den rekommenderade cachestorleken för Standard_E32s_v3 noder.

Mer information om dessa virtuella datorer finns i Microsoft Azure-dokumentationen: Minnesoptimerade storlekar för virtuella datorer

Kontokvot

Kontrollera att din prenumeration har kapacitet att köra Avere vFXT-klustret samt alla databehandlings- eller klientsystem som används. Läs Kvot för vFXT-klustret för mer information.

Serverdelsdatalagring

Serverdelslagringssystem tillhandahåller både filer till klustrets cacheminne och tar även emot ändrade data från cacheminnet. Bestäm om din arbetsuppsättning ska lagras långsiktigt i en ny blobcontainer eller i ett befintligt lagringssystem (moln eller maskinvara). Dessa serverdelslagringssystem kallas kärnfiler.

Maskinvarukärnfiler

Lägg till maskinvarulagringssystem i vFXT-klustret när du har skapat klustret. Du kan använda en mängd olika populära maskinvarusystem, inklusive lokala system, så länge lagringssystemet kan nås från klustrets undernät.

Läs Konfigurera lagring för detaljerade instruktioner om hur du lägger till ett befintligt lagringssystem i Avere vFXT-klustret.

Molnkärnfiler

Avere vFXT för Azure-systemet kan använda tomma Blob-containrar för serverdelslagring. Containrar måste vara tomma när de läggs till i klustret – vFXT-systemet måste kunna hantera dess objektlager utan att behöva bevara befintliga data.

Dricks

Om du vill använda Azure Blob Storage för serverdelen skapar du en ny container som en del av skapandet av vFXT-klustret. Mallen för att skapa kluster kan skapa och konfigurera en ny blobcontainer så att den är redo att användas så snart klustret är tillgängligt. Det är mer komplicerat att lägga till en container senare.

Mer information finns i Skapa Avere vFXT för Azure .

När du har lagt till den tomma Blob Storage-containern som en kärnfil kan du kopiera data till den via klustret. Använd en parallell, flertrådad kopieringsmekanism. Läs Flytta data till vFXT-klustret för att lära dig hur du kopierar data till klustrets nya container effektivt med hjälp av klientdatorer och Avere vFXT-cachen.

Klusteråtkomst

Avere vFXT för Azure-klustret finns i ett privat undernät och klustret har ingen offentlig IP-adress. Du måste ha något sätt att komma åt det privata undernätet för klusteradministration och klientanslutningar.

Åtkomstalternativen omfattar:

  • Jump Host – Tilldela en offentlig IP-adress till en separat virtuell dator i det privata nätverket och använd den för att skapa en TLS-tunnel till klusternoderna.

    Dricks

    Om du anger en offentlig IP-adress på klusterstyrenheten kan du använda den som jump-värd. Läs Klusterstyrenhet som jump-värd för mer information.

  • Virtuellt privat nätverk (VPN) – Konfigurera ett punkt-till-plats- eller plats-till-plats-VPN mellan ditt privata nätverk i Azure och företagsnätverk.

  • Azure ExpressRoute – Konfigurera en privat anslutning via en ExpressRoute-partner.

Mer information om de här alternativen finns i dokumentationen om Internetkommunikation i Azure Virtual Network.

Klusterstyrenhet som hoppvärd

Om du anger en offentlig IP-adress på klusterstyrenheten kan du använda den som en snabbvärd för att kontakta Avere vFXT-klustret utanför det privata undernätet. Men eftersom kontrollanten har åtkomstbehörighet för att ändra klusternoder skapar detta en liten säkerhetsrisk.

För att förbättra säkerheten för en kontrollant med en offentlig IP-adress skapar distributionsskriptet automatiskt en nätverkssäkerhetsgrupp som endast begränsar inkommande åtkomst till port 22. Du kan skydda systemet ytterligare genom att låsa åtkomsten till ditt intervall med IP-källadresser, dvs. endast tillåta anslutningar från datorer som du tänker använda för klusteråtkomst.

När du skapar klustret kan du välja om du vill skapa en offentlig IP-adress på klusterstyrenheten eller inte.

  • Om du skapar ett nytt virtuellt nätverk eller ett nytt undernät tilldelas klusterstyrenheten en offentlig IP-adress.
  • Om du väljer ett befintligt virtuellt nätverk och undernät har klusterstyrenheten endast privata IP-adresser.

Åtkomstroller för virtuella datorer

Azure använder rollbaserad åtkomstkontroll i Azure (Azure RBAC) för att ge de virtuella klusterdatorerna behörighet att utföra vissa uppgifter. Klusterstyrenheten behöver till exempel auktorisering för att skapa och konfigurera de virtuella datorerna för klusternoden. Klusternoder måste kunna tilldela eller omtilldela IP-adresser till andra klusternoder.

Två inbyggda Azure-roller används för virtuella Avere vFXT-datorer:

Om du behöver anpassa åtkomstroller för Avere vFXT-komponenter måste du definiera din egen roll och sedan tilldela den till de virtuella datorerna när de skapas. Du kan inte använda distributionsmallen på Azure Marketplace. Kontakta Microsofts kundtjänst och support genom att öppna ett ärende i Azure-portalen enligt beskrivningen i Få hjälp med ditt system.

Nästa steg

Distributionsöversikten ger en översikt över de steg som krävs för att skapa ett Avere vFXT för Azure-system och göra det redo att hantera data.